Port Macquarie-Hastings Bridge Club celebrates its 30th anniversary in 2019 - a significant milestone in playing and promoting the virtues of the world's most popular card game.

In the late 1980s a group of dedicated founding members secured the lease of suitable land from the then-Hastings Council and conducted a broad range of fundraising activities to commence and complete construction of a clubhouse.
The resulting facility at Hamilton Green opened in 1989 and has been called home by many hundreds of Bridge players ever since.
While Bridge Clubs across the nation aspire to operate from their own premises, relatively few manage to do so given the logistical and financial hurdles involved.
Accordingly, this anniversary favourably emphasises the stability, management and operation of Port Macquarie-Hastings Bridge Club for the last 30 years.
A mainstay of the Club's activities since 1989 has been the lesson programs for new players run by founding member and grand master, Yvonne Cains.
These programs serve a dual purpose: on the one hand, like clubs of all persuasions, the Bridge Club needs to constantly attract new members in order to keep growing while, on the other hand, new players need a thorough grounding in order to be successful in playing the game.
Yvonne's lessons program involves a weekly session each Friday morning from 9am until noon over four months and covers all aspects of the game including hand evaluation, bidding, responding, defending, card play techniques, advanced conventions and game etiquette.
There is a lot of practice play built into each session so that learners can apply the techniques of each week's lesson.
The objective is to graduate new players who have a sound basic understanding of the game but, more importantly, have confidence in their ability and enjoy participating and socialising with their fellow bridge players.
